Mission
Help improve people’s lives by assisting policy makers and stakeholders at all levels to design and implement actionable public policy solutions, and by furthering public debate on the most important development challenges facing Ukraine.

Principles
The basic principles governing the Foundation’s activities are independence, focus on economic development, openness, and a practice-oriented approach.

Independence
The Foundation serves the interests of Ukrainian citizens, not political parties or business groups. The Foundation attracts employees and experts with diverse political backgrounds. The Foundation is open to cooperation with everyone who supports its mission and principles and respects its political neutrality.

Focus on economic development
The Foundation will develop programs for sustainable economic development. Only long-term economic growth will improve the welfare of citizens, and provide the country with funds for education, health care, and pensions.

Openness
The Foundation will involve representatives of Ukrainian academia, business, and civil society to discuss and develop programs and projects. The Foundation will facilitate public discussion of the most country’s most important development issues.

Practice-oriented approach
The Foundation strives to develop practical proposals and recommendations for authorities at central, regional, and local levels. To ensure the practicality of its recommendations, the Foundation will involve leading Ukrainian and international economic reform specialists and experts in the development of proposals.
